Progesterone testing is not a viable method for diagnosing endometrial cancer. Typically, screening for endometrial cancer is not recommended, as many instances are identified early due to observable symptoms. However, progesterone levels are linked to endometrial cancer in two primary ways. Firstly, hormonal imbalances, specifically elevated estrogen and decreased progesterone levels, can raise the risk of developing endometrial cancer. Secondly, for women seeking to maintain their fertility, progesterone therapy may serve as a treatment option for certain types of endometrial cancer.

The lack of a reliable biomarker for endometrial cancer complicates diagnosis and can lead to unnecessary biopsies. While progesterone levels are considered in the diagnostic process, they do not provide sufficient detail on their own. Future research may uncover additional targeted biomarkers, potentially changing the role of progesterone testing.
